Impala Platinum Considers Reducing Headcount by 2,500

Impala Platinum Holdings Ltd. (IMP.JO) is considering reducing the headcount at its Impala Rustenburg operation due to severe financial pressure, the company said on Monday.

The South African platinum mining company said that it expects to let go some 2,500 people in the short term, with further staff reductions possible in the future.

Low metal prices, higher production costs, and falling productivity has impacted the financial sustainability of the company, said Impala, making the layoffs necessary.
